Microphone Lowers Game Volume in Recordings...

Tue Dec 23, 2014 11:51 pm

Just picked this up. I like the video quality... just having a ton of audio issues. I have a mic hooked up to my motherboard (on-board sound). My headset is also plugged in the same way. I have the Action! program set to record both my microphone, and in-game audio. The mic is set to the same button I use as my Push to Talk for TeamSpeak.

When I record in-game, the audio of my mic lowers the game volume (takes over the audio track almost muting every other sound). How do I stop this from happening?
